Description

Vans is a well-established streetwear label based in California, founded by brothers Paul Van Doren and James Van Doren along with other partners in 1966. Vans has been a major influencer in sports, especially in skateboarding, surf and BMX. A plethora of collaborations range from high-end fashion houses such as COMME des GARÇONS, Kenzo and Raf Simons to streetwear brands like Gosha Rubchinskiy, Supreme and Thrasher Magazine.
